Zitat von
Tool-Box:
Ich habe gelesen, dass auf der Delphi 8 (octane) auch die Delphi 7 Version beigelegt sein soll. Weisst du, ob auch Kylix 3 mit enthalten sein wird ?
Da kann auch ich nur sagen: Mal bei Borland anrufen...
Die liebe Frau am Borland-Telefon sagte unverbindlich
Prinzipiell wird Kylix nicht zusammen mit Delphi 8 (Octane) ausgeliefert. Es wird zur Zeit jedoch darüber seniert, ob es unter Umständen eine Promotionaktion geben wird, zu welcher während der Einführung Kylix enthalten ist.
Zitat von
Tool-Box:
Desweiteren habe ich hier irgendwo gelesen, dass unter Delphi.Net der Befehl "File of..." nicht mehr unterstützt werden soll.
Wie müsste untengenannter Record aus Pascal in Delphi umgeschrieben werden ?
Das wirst Du am Besten komplett auf Streams ausweichen - sollte man schon jetzt tun, wenn es geht
Mit obiger
Type-Strukture sähe es dann wie folgend aus:
Delphi-Quellcode:
var
DbEntry: Datenbank_Spiel_77;
FS: TFileStream;
begin
// Datei öffnen
FS := TFileStream.Create('data.file', fmOpenReadWrite or fmShareDenyNone);
try
// read 3 data entry
FS.Position := SizeOf(Datenbank_Spiel_77) * (3 - 1);
FS.Read(DbEntry, SizeOf(Datenbank_Spiel_77));
...
// save at first position
FS.Position := 0;
FS.Write(DbEntry, SizeOf(Datenbank_Spiel_77));
finally
// Datei schließen
FS.Free;
end;
...
...